Pandora’s repertoire is a collage of the classical, the traditional and the contemporary, and features original works as well as arrangements for mandolin ensemble. Arrangments of classical pieces include works by William Byrd, J.S. Bach, Maurice Ravel, Orlando Respighi, Gustav Holst, and Peter Warlock. Arrangements of more traditional pieces include Percy Grainger’s settings of English folk tunes, and arrangements of Hebrew songs and American spirituals by Rhode Island’s Will Ayton. Tim Ware, Jonathan Jenson, and Jeff Dearinger have also contributed contemporary compositions for mandolin ensemble. |
